To those who are "disappointed" with Flash 8


I’ve seen a few posts here and there.

First of all, how can you be disappointed with something after less than a day using it? I know you haven’t scratched the surface yet. It looks like the same old Flash, but there is a lot under the hood that you can’t see. You need to dig around for a while.

OK, you are disappointed because you were really hoping for “feature X”, when feature X was never mentioned as part of Flash 8, and in some cases was specifically said that feature X was NOT going to be part of Flash 8.

OK, let’s talk specifics on that one. No V3 components. Same old ones you don’t like. I don’t like them either. I don’t use them. But a new set of components wasn’t in the cards this release. Oh well. Macromedia has been saying that for months. It’s like if your parents have been telling you all year, no pony for Christmas. Then you wake up on Christmas morning and rush out to the tree and are “disappointed” that there is no pony. A pony would have been nice, but let’s not ignore the mountain of other presents there. Besides, Im betting MM has plenty of surprises up their sleeves in the component / RIA department.

Finally, my advice. download and install the trial. It’s free. OK, you probably have already, hence the “disappointment”. Anyway, use it exclusively for 30 days, uninstall it and go back to Flash MX 2004. Then you will know the meaning of the word disappointment!
